Medicare and also personal health insurance will certainly cover cataract surgical treatment gave that it's deemed medically required. However, people will need to pay an insurance deductible and also copays.
The quantity of the annual deductible and copayment requirements will differ relying on your private insurance policy strategy choices. The cataract surgical treatment cost will certainly additionally vary relying on the type of lens you choose.

Costs lenses, like those that correct for astigmatism or eliminate the requirement for glasses or call lenses, aren't covered by Medicare because they're considered optional rather than clinically required.
Expenses Associated with Picking a Surgical Center
Medicare and personal health insurance usually cover typical cataract surgical treatment, yet the specifics of a person's coverage may differ. For example, a person with Medicare could require to satisfy a vision test threshold prior to cataracts are considered serious enough for the treatment to be covered. A person with personal insurance coverage may need to pay a deductible or copayment for the treatment.
People should likewise think about just how much the surgeon's center fee will cost, which can differ depending on where a person has their surgical treatment executed. For example, an ambulatory surgical facility (ASC) is generally more economical than a healthcare facility outpatient division.
Patients ought to ask their ophthalmologist whether their insurance strategy covers two surgical procedures per eye, which can save on prices. They should also talk to their ophthalmologist concerning payment plans and see if they can use funds from flexible investing accounts or wellness savings accounts to assist pay for the procedure.

The price of cataract surgery varies, depending on where you live and your insurance coverage. Usually, insurance coverage will cover a lot of your surgical procedure expenditures if they are thought about clinically needed. This means that the cataract needs to have advanced sufficient to hinder your vision to a certain level outlined in your policy.
During the treatment, your ophthalmologist will certainly use an unique microscope to view the inside of your eye. You will certainly receive numbing medication with eye declines or a fired around the eye, and after that a little cut (cut) is made in the eye. Your doctor will then eliminate your gloomy lens and put the brand-new IOL.
Your doctor might offer a range of IOLs, consisting of conventional monofocal lenses, multifocal IOLs, or toric IOLs that correct astigmatism. You can review the options with your eye doctor to identify which would certainly best suit your demands.

Cataract surgical procedure is commonly thought about to be medically essential by personal health insurance as well as Medicare (components A & B). In many cases, these plans cover most of costs after the yearly insurance deductible has been met.
It is essential to go over every one of the prices connected with cataract surgical treatment freely with your cosmetic surgeon. In this way, you can stay clear of any unexpected or surprise costs that might occur during the treatment.
The underlying health of the eye, the kind of lens made use of, as well as the surgical technique all affect the overall cost. You need to additionally review what is covered by your insurance plan to stay clear of any kind of surprises.
Personal health insurance companies as well as Medicare Benefit plans usually cover the expenses of typical monofocal cataract surgical procedure, yet specifics vary by private policy or service provider. You can likewise save cash on out-of-pocket health care prices by contributing to a versatile costs account (FSA), which allows you to subtract pre-tax income from your paycheck each pay period.
